Pierre-Emerick Aubameyang's Loan Move To Barcelona Falls Through After He Travels To Spain

It looks like he will remain an Arsenal player.

Pierre-Emerick Aubameyang's proposed loan move to Barcelona has fallen through, just hours after the Arsenal forward was spotted in a Spanish airport on transfer deadline day.

The Gabon international, who is currently on a reported £350,000-a-week at Arsenal, had an agreement in principle to join the La Liga side on loan.

And on Monday morning, Aubameyang was filmed leaving El Prat airport before being pictured in a car nearby.

Despite travelling to Barcelona in the hope of securing a transfer, it was said that a deal would only go through if the Spanish giants managed to offload at least one player in the coming hours, per The Guardian.

Ousmane Dembele was one of the names being linked with a move away from the Camp Nou. In fact, The Independent say Dembele was offered to Arsenal as part of the Aubameyang deal.

But it didn't take long for transfer expert Fabrizio Romano to confirm that Dembele had no interest in joining Arsenal.

According to initial reports, Aubameyang travelled to Barcelona in the hope of completing a deal but new details have emerged surrounding Aubameyang's intentions in regards to the trip.

The Athletic correspondent David Ornstein says the 32-year-old striker will now return to London from what is said to have been a 'family trip' to the Spanish city.

The report also states that the proposed loan deal collapsed because of a disagreement over salary.

Some on social media have since compared Aubameyang's situation to that of Peter Odemwingie, the former West Brom striker who travelled 120 miles to QPR's training ground in an attempt to force through a deal.

Unfortunately for Odemwingie, a transfer never materialised and this infamous clip was born.

Aubameyang has been linked with a transfer since being stripped of the captaincy in December following another disciplinary breach.

He hasn't featured for the North London club since their 2-1 defeat to Everton on December 6.
